desktop(installer): add icon generation script and ensure installer/uninstaller use multi-res ICO\n\n- Add apps/desktop/scripts/build-icon.mjs using png-to-ico\n- Add script in apps/desktop/package.json\n- Set NSIS uninstallerIcon to icons/icon.ico\n\nUsage: pnpm -C apps/desktop install && pnpm -C apps/desktop gen:icon && pnpm -C apps/desktop tauri build --bundles nsis
This commit is contained in:
parent
f986fc667d
commit
29d5a07588
4 changed files with 42 additions and 1 deletions
BIN
apps/desktop/src-tauri/icons/Square310x310Logo.bmp
Normal file
BIN
apps/desktop/src-tauri/icons/Square310x310Logo.bmp
Normal file
Binary file not shown.
|
After Width: | Height: | Size: 376 KiB |
|
|
@ -53,6 +53,7 @@
|
|||
"nsis": {
|
||||
"displayLanguageSelector": true,
|
||||
"installerIcon": "icons/icon.ico",
|
||||
"uninstallerIcon": "icons/icon.ico",
|
||||
"headerImage": "icons/nsis-header.bmp",
|
||||
"sidebarImage": "icons/nsis-sidebar.bmp",
|
||||
"installMode": "perMachine",
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ue